Lil B, the prolific Berkeley, CA rapper, is looking to drop his latest mixtape Thugged Out Pissed Out shortly (first since collaborating with Chance the Rapper back in August), and he’s already sharing its first offering in a bit of urban menace many have forgotten existed within The BasedGod’s mutated rap DNA. The track–along with a standard DIY music video for YouTube–finds Lil B going over an eerie beat, rapping about “the underworld” which, according to Lil B, he was “raised up” in. Additionally, Lil B directly acknowledges chart-topping Canadian recording artist The Weeknd (whose stock only continues to rise) with lyrics like “Call me Lil Bars with the XO Bars/ Saying fuck The Weeknd, I can’t sing that soft”, and “A lot of suckas fake, so I can’t respect it/ Fuck The Weeknd, put that on record,” rapped repeatedly–apparently BasedGod really doesn’t like the singer-songwriter.
